  1. I was able to get the deluxe beverage package for my 11/13 sailing a few weeks ago for $68/day. Currently and for the last week or so it's fluctuated between $73 and $78/day + grat. The going rate right now for my cruise, the refreshment package is $30/day and soda package is $8.99/day.

     

    Honestly, check every day and sometimes multiple times a day. The prices are usually fluctuating and that's how I saved $10/day/person on my deluxe bev package. You can also do what I and many others do and pay for it at its current price and then if you find it cheaper you can cancel and get it refunded and re-purchase at the new lower price.

  6. My experience in May in Miami ( Vista).

    1) Arrived at 10:30 for 11:30 check in.

    2) Went to early/late line.

    3) Walked straight through to check in rep.

    4) Scanned Boarding Passes , received Boarding #

    5) Put personal items/carry through security

    6) Waited in boarding area

     

    Note: They weren't busy at all, we were willing to wait if turned away, and did as Carnival's procedure is set up ( going in appropriate line) early/late.

     

    It may change from week to week, for us it worked.
